    Bulgaria EU Funds co-financing 2007-13 projects
    The Republic of Bulgaria, through the Ministry of Finance (Borrower and Payment authority for the EU programmes), and other Ministries involved as Management Authorities in the National Strategic Reference Framework (NSRF) 2007-13, as well as in measures included in European Agricultural Fund for Rural Development (EAFRD) programme.
    Proposed EIB finance (Approximate amount)
    Total cost (Approximate amount)
    The EIB loan is expected to cover up to 20% of the eligible cost.
    The cost eligible to the Bank’s project will be determined during appraisal as a part of the NSRF and Rural Development programmes. It is expected to amount to about EUR 3.5 billion,.
    Description
    Objectives

    The project will support a number of investment schemes eligible to the Structural Funds and Cohesion Fund grants in the programming period 2007-13. These will be included in the relevant Operational Programmes in the areas of industry, services, transport, environment, local basic infrastructure, research and development, information society, measures of rural development and others.

    The project aims at both facilitating and accelerating the implementation of investment schemes responding to EU policy priorities for the further development of the economy and its faster integration into the Union’s. Through the support of its technical services, as well as that from Jaspers, Jeremie and Jessica, the EIB group will also give a contribution to the overall programme implementation of the Bulgarian NSRF and Rural Development.

    Procurement

    These will be verified according to current environmental impact legislation in the Republic of Bulgaria in line with relevant EU legislation (namely Directive 85/337/EEC as amended by Directive 97/11/EC and 2003/35/EC).

    EU Directives for procurement have been transposed into national Bulgarian legislation. Tenders will be organized in compliance with EU requirements, which is also a precondition for EU grant support. Tender notices will be published, as appropriate, in the EU Official Journal. Application of EU procedures by the Bulgarian authorities for the tender of services, supplies and civil works will be reviewed by the Bank’s services during appraisal.
